It's important to understand that every personal injury or wrongful death case has a time limit called a statute of limitations. This defines the time period in which you or your family may file a lawsuit. If you do not file your case within the time period mandated by state law, you could forever be barred from bringing a claim. This means time is of the essence: In addition to meeting any filing deadlines, your lawyers must gather all facts, interview all witnesses, investigate the scene of the accident and obtain any necessary documents quickly to ensure evidence is preserved and your case can be set for an expeditious trial.
